Struct FaultPolicy 

Source
pub struct FaultPolicy { /* private fields */ }
Expand description

The validated retry, backoff, skip, and rollback policy for one step.

The runnable example lives in the oxide-batch facade documentation, because the supported import path is oxide_batch.

Implementations§

Source§

impl FaultPolicy

Source

pub fn new( classifier: FaultClassifier, retry_limit: RetryLimit, retry_state_limit: RetryStateLimit, skip_limit: SkipLimit, backoff: BackoffPolicy, ) -> Result<Self, FaultPolicyError>

Validates and constructs the step policy.

§Errors

Rejects a retry rule that no retry limit can ever satisfy, so a statically impossible combination cannot reach the runtime.

Source

pub const fn classifier(&self) -> &FaultClassifier

Borrows the classifier.

Source

pub const fn retry_limit(&self) -> RetryLimit

Returns the configured retry limit.

Source

pub const fn retry_state_limit(&self) -> RetryStateLimit

Returns the unresolved retry-key capacity for one step.

Source

pub const fn skip_limit(&self) -> SkipLimit

Returns the aggregate skip limit.

Source

pub const fn backoff(&self) -> BackoffPolicy

Returns the backoff schedule.

Source

pub fn requires_commit_safe_skip(&self) -> bool

Returns whether any rule accepts a commit-safe skip.

Source

pub fn validate_capabilities( &self, supports_atomic_skip: bool, ) -> Result<(), FaultPolicyError>

Verifies the selected resource can honour the policy before user work.

§Errors

Returns FaultPolicyError::CommitSafeSkipUnsupported when a rule accepts a commit-safe skip that the transaction capability cannot commit atomically.

Source

pub fn decide( &self, fault: &FaultDescriptor, evidence: FaultEvidence, ) -> FaultDecision

Returns the authoritative decision for one fault.

The decision is a pure function of the policy, the framework-owned descriptor, and framework evidence, so it is reproducible after a restart.
